Key Takeaways
- Automating Instagram DMs allows you to respond and trigger conversations without constant manual management.
- You can use basic Instagram features such as welcome messages, away messages, and saved replies, or implement advanced DM automation through API-based integrations.
- Automated DM flows are triggered by real user actions, including keyword comments, Story replies, mentions, or direct messages.
- Automation transforms Instagram DMs into a structured channel for capturing leads, delivering resources, and managing promotions.
- When implemented correctly, DM automation reduces operational workload while maintaining control and consistency in your brand communication.
Industry benchmarks show that Instagram Stories generate a meaningful volume of Direct Message replies. When a user replies to a Story, a private DM conversation opens automatically. For brands, this creates a clear opportunity to start one-to-one conversations.
The challenge appears when message volume grows: manual replies become unsustainable, interactions get lost or remain unstructured, and it becomes harder to turn that interest into a concrete action.
The good news is that yes, it is possible to automate Instagram Direct Messages. Automation does not mean removing the human element. It means organizing the conversations that are already happening, triggering responses based on user actions, and replying efficiently without losing closeness.
In this guide, we explain step by step how to automate Instagram Direct Messages, what options are available, and how to structure conversations in a professional way.
Can You Automate Instagram DMs?
Yes. It is possible to automate private messages when users interact with a brand’s content. The DM channel was originally designed as a simple private communication space where messages were handled manually. As usage increased, Meta introduced ways to automate responses through Meta Business Suite and, more importantly, by opening the API with Instagram Login so external platforms like Easypromos can build more advanced automation flows.
Instagram Messaging Automations allow you to initiate automated conversations in Direct Messages and send private messages when users comment on a post, reply to a Story, mention your account, or send a DM. The conversation is triggered by a real user action, without constant manual management, and the entire interaction remains within Instagram.
What Types of Instagram Messages Can You Automate?
With Meta Business Suite, Instagram’s native tool, you can configure several basic automated actions:
- Basic automatic replies in Direct Messages
- A welcome message when someone starts a conversation
- Saved replies to insert manually
- An away message outside business hours

However, these options have important limitations. They do not activate automatically when someone comments on a post with a keyword, they do not detect keywords in comments or messages to trigger flows, and they do not allow you to structure conversations with buttons, dynamic links, or sequenced steps. They also cannot connect conversations directly to promotions or more advanced actions. They save some time, but they do not fully structure your DM workflow.

In any case, let’s look at how these options are configured to better understand how basic message automation works using only Instagram’s native tools.
Enable a Welcome Message When Someone Starts a Conversation
An instant reply is sent automatically when someone sends their first message or opens a chat.

How to set it up
- Go to Meta Business Suite and access your connected Instagram account
- Open Inbox > Automations
- Select Instant Reply
- Turn the automation on
- Edit the automation and customize the response message
Example: “Thank you for contacting us. We’ve received your message and will respond as soon as possible.”
It’s important to remember that this message is sent only once per conversation and does not replace the manual response that follows.
Create Saved Replies to Copy and Paste Manually
This feature is not true automation, but a shortcut system. It allows you to save predefined messages that the account manager can quickly insert by typing a configured command or keyword.
The message is still sent manually. The team must open the conversation, enter the shortcut, and send the reply. It does not activate automatically when a user starts a chat or uses specific words.
It also does not allow you to structure an automated flow with buttons or follow-up actions. While this option saves time compared to writing each message from scratch, it does not guarantee an immediate response, since it depends on the manager’s availability.

How to set it up
- Go to Meta Business Suite and access your connected Instagram account
- Go to your Inbox
- Open any DM conversation
- Click the saved replies icon (speech bubble or lightning bolt, depending on the version)
- Create a new saved reply
- Assign a shortcut (for example: /hours)
To use this feature, you must type the shortcut word so the saved message appears. For example, typing “/hours” in a conversation will auto-fill the predefined text you saved earlier.
Set an Out-of-Office Message Outside Business Hours
To activate an out-of-office message, update your status to “Away” in your inbox or schedule specific hours while editing the message. For example, you can customize the message to inform users how long you will be unavailable and when they can expect a response.

How to set it up
- Go to Meta Business Suite and access your connected Instagram account
- Open Inbox > Automations
- Select Away message
- Turn the automation on
- Edit the schedule and customize the response message
Example: “Our business hours are Monday to Friday from 9:00 AM to 6:00 PM. We’ve received your message and will reply as soon as we’re back.”
Beyond these basic automations, Meta does not offer additional configuration options. That’s why many brands turn to external solutions to optimize how they manage Instagram DMs.
What Types of Messages Can You Automate in the DM Channel with External Tools
Features to Welcome Users to Your Direct Message Channel
- A welcome message is an instant reply that is automatically sent when someone sends their first message or starts a chat. It is configured through Meta Business Suite.
- Ice Breakers are predefined questions or actions that automatically appear the first time a user opens a Direct Message conversation. Their purpose is to make it easier to start the interaction without requiring the user to type manually. Ice Breakers are configured exclusively through the Instagram API and allow you to create up to four predefined questions. Their main advantage is that when a user taps one of the options, it automatically triggers a response or flow, speeding up the first interaction and structuring the conversation from the very beginning.

- The Persistent Menu is a menu that remains permanently visible within Direct Messages and provides shortcuts to content, promotions, or key business information throughout the conversation. It allows brands to share essential information, provide relevant links, or highlight ongoing promotions, keeping them accessible to users at any time during the interaction. The Persistent Menu is configured exclusively through the Instagram API.

Both Ice Breakers and the Persistent Menu are only visible in the mobile version of Instagram. They are not displayed to users on the desktop version.
Instagram Direct Message Automations
Instagram message automations allow you to structure conversations inside DMs based on real user interactions. They are not limited to sending a single message; instead, they can organize a logical sequence of automated responses.
- Content Delivery (PDFs, Coupons, or Resources). Automated messages can include direct links to downloadable resources such as catalogs, checklists, or coupons. These can be configured as buttons within the message. This makes it possible to instantly deliver the promised content right after the user interaction. A common use case is sending a downloadable resource automatically after a user comments a specific keyword on a post, keeping the entire experience within Instagram.
- Links to External Pages. Automations can also include links to external URLs, such as a landing page, an online store, or an active promotion. The link can appear directly in the message or be attached to a button, making it easy for the user to continue their journey toward a specific action.
- Question-and-Answer Sequences. You can design structured conversations using messages with buttons. Each user click can trigger a new automated message, allowing you to create survey-style flows, option selection paths, or interest-based classifications. This enables users to move step by step within the chat without manual intervention.
- Polls in Direct Messages. There is no official poll sticker or built-in voting feature inside DMs. However, you can simulate polls through conversational flows using button-based messages. In practice, this works by sending a question followed by multiple button options. Each button automatically triggers a new message, allowing you to continue with follow-up questions or display a final result based on the user’s selection.
Strategy to Move from Comments to DMs on Instagram
The Comment to DM strategy consists of automatically triggering a private conversation when followers use a specific activation keyword in a post or Reel. This transforms a public interaction into a personalized dialogue inside Instagram DMs, making it easier to structure the conversation and guide the user toward a specific action.
Without a defined strategy and a tool that allows you to automate the process, this dynamic can quickly become an operational burden: reviewing comments, manually identifying keywords, sending messages one by one, and monitoring activity 24/7. Without automation, the workload is constant and requires ongoing manual effort from the team.
The key advantages of this strategy are:
- Move public interactions into a private channel, strengthening the relationship with the user and enabling more personalized communication.
- Faster conversion, since users receive information or resources almost instantly after interacting.
- Reduced manual workload, because messages are sent automatically without reviewing and replying one by one.
- Greater organic reach, as comments increase post visibility within Instagram.
Examples of Comment-to-DM Actions on Instagram
- From a Post Comment to a Direct Message. The travel agency Discovering Japan created an Instagram automation to increase newsletter subscriptions. When a user commented on a post using the activation keyword “JAPAN,” a Direct Message was automatically sent requesting confirmation to continue the conversation in the private channel. After clicking the button, the user received the first newsletter along with the option to subscribe permanently.

- From a Reel Comment to a Direct Message. The media outlet Catalunya Ràdio launched a new program focused on health advice. To support the launch, they published a Reel featuring tips to reduce anxiety. To access the full video, users had to comment on the Reel using the activation keyword “SALUT.” Once they did, they automatically received a Direct Message with access to the complete content.

Tips for Your Comment-to-DM Strategy on Instagram
- Choose a Relevant Activation Keyword. Define an activation keyword that makes sense and is directly related to the content or incentive the user will receive. It should be clear, easy to remember, and aligned with the message of the post.
- Make the Call to Action Explicit. Clearly state in the Reel or post that users must comment with that specific word to receive the incentive. The clearer the call to action, the higher the initial volume of comments.
- Deliver Real Value in the DM. Even if the message is sent automatically, make sure it provides genuine value: a discount, a useful resource, access to a promotion, or exclusive content. Automation should never feel empty or purely mechanical.
- Monitor Comments to Maintain Quality. Keep an eye on comments to prevent spam and maintain conversation quality. Automation does not replace human judgment in community management.
- Reinforce the Strategy with Stories. Support the strategy by publishing Stories that use polls or question boxes to generate additional interactions that can later be moved into DMs.
- Continue Responding Manually When Appropriate. Keep replying manually to comments that do not include the activation keyword. This maintains closeness and helps build an authentic community beyond the automated dynamic.
Other Automation Examples
- Activation Keyword Directly in DMs. Another way to automate DMs is by triggering the conversation when a user sends a specific keyword directly in the Direct Message channel. For example, if a user sends the activation keyword “CUPONEASY,” the automation detects the term and automatically replies with a message that includes a downloadable coupon.

- Reply to a Story with a Keyword to Trigger a DM. In this case, the travel agency Llums de l’Àrtic promoted its participation in a tourism trade fair and offered the option to book a meeting through Instagram Stories. Interested users had to reply to the Story with the activation keyword “BTRAVEL”. Once they did, they automatically received a Direct Message with a link to schedule their appointment.

- Story Mention to Trigger a DM. A public mention from another account can also automatically trigger a private message, without requiring any activation keyword. In this example, the brand asked users to post a Story featuring one of its products and mention the account to enter a giveaway. Once the mention was detected, the user automatically received a Direct Message.

Learn more about the features and applications of Instagram Messaging Automation.
First Steps to Create a DM Automation
Automation is not just about sending a message when someone comments on a post or replies to a Story. The real value lies in designing a strategic journey within Instagram Direct Messages.
Before activating anything, define the objective you want to achieve: generate leads, deliver a resource, promote an offer, or resolve frequently asked questions. From there, choose the most appropriate setup and structure the conversation with a clear logic. Once the automation is live, analyze the results to understand which activations perform best and how to optimize impact.
To structure an automated conversation effectively, follow these key steps.
- Define the Objective of the Automation
A well-designed automated conversation must have a clear goal from the start. This could be encouraging a purchase with a coupon, educating users with a downloadable PDF, increasing engagement through a giveaway, capturing user data, resolving FAQs, or driving traffic to a website. Automation is not about replying for the sake of replying. It is about designing interactions with intention and configuring the tool according to that strategy.
- Design the Journey from the First Message
The first message should contextualize the user’s action. For example, if someone comments “INFO” on a Reel, the DM can confirm that they requested information, deliver the promised resource (such as a guide or catalog), and offer a clear next step with a button. The message should not close the conversation. It should open a path forward. Define where the conversation begins and how you want it to evolve.
- Offer a Valuable Resource or Incentive
Users interact via DM because they expect something in return: information, a benefit, a reward, or exclusive access. Define what incentive or resource you will offer to motivate interaction. This is where the conversation gains strategic value: the user remains inside Instagram until they decide to move elsewhere.
- Close with a Purposeful Final Message
The final message allows you to end the flow with intention: confirm that the process was completed successfully, thank the user for their interest, or suggest a next step to keep the conversation active. When used correctly, it does more than close the sequence. It reinforces the experience and can open the door to further actions within the DM channel.
- Measure and Segment from the Conversation List
Conversations managed with professional tools are recorded in the Conversation List. This allows you to identify and segment users who have interacted with your brand. Automation then becomes more than an operational resource, and it turns into a strategic marketing asset. You can encourage participants to follow your account, reward them with a giveaway, identify highly engaged profiles, or design specific actions to convert them into customers.
Structuring an automated DM conversation means designing a clear journey within the channel: trigger the conversation from a real interaction, deliver immediate value, and guide the user toward a specific action. All within Instagram and fully measurable.
How to Choose an Instagram DM Automation Solution
Not all solutions that automate Instagram messages offer the same level of control and scalability. If interaction volume grows or the channel becomes part of your commercial strategy, the tool must meet certain key requirements:
- Trigger automations from real interactions. Comments with activation keywords, Story replies, Story mentions, or incoming Direct Messages. Automation should react to specific user actions, not depend on manual sending.
- Send links and resources in a structured way. Not just plain text, but buttons, downloadable assets, or content access points that move the conversation forward.
- Connect conversations with promotions and interactive campaigns. This turns the DM channel from a simple response mechanism into a gateway to richer brand experiences such as giveaways, contests, or interactive dynamics.
- Track and identify users who interact. Counting sent messages is not enough. You need to know how many unique users started a conversation, which activation triggered it, and what results were generated.
- Avoid dependency on developers. Configuration should be simple and intuitive so marketing teams can create, modify, and activate automations independently.
- Scale without losing control or traceability. If a campaign generates hundreds or thousands of interactions, the structure must remain stable, organized, and measurable.
When these criteria are met, automation stops being a tactical solution and becomes part of a structured engagement and acquisition strategy within Instagram.
Try Easypromos’ Instagram Messaging Automation now. Free access, no credit card required, and a 7-day trial.
Common Mistakes When Automating Instagram Messages
Automating Instagram messages can create significant value, but only when approached strategically. These are five common mistakes brands make when implementing automations:
- Automating isolated replies only. Setting up a single automated message without continuity turns automation into nothing more than a quick reply. If there is no follow-up path, button, resource, or next step, the conversation ends prematurely and the opportunity is lost.
- Not connecting the conversation to a concrete action. The DM channel should not be limited to providing information. It can serve as the entry point to a promotion, a downloadable resource, or a participatory dynamic. Without a clear action, the impact remains superficial.
- Failing to measure real impact. Many accounts activate automations but do not analyze results. They do not know how many unique users initiated a conversation, which activation performs best, or which resource generates the most clicks. Without measurement, the channel cannot be optimized.
- Not structuring the conversation flow. Automatically replying is not the same as designing a structured flow. Without a clear sequence, users receive fragmented information with no guidance. A well-designed automated conversation should guide, not just respond.
- Confusing automation with basic customer support. Automations are not only meant to answer frequently asked questions. Their potential goes further: they can activate campaigns, generate leads, deliver content, and turn interaction into business opportunities.
When these mistakes are avoided, the DM channel stops being a reactive inbox and becomes an organized, measurable space aligned with your broader digital strategy.
Automating Instagram DM Messages FAQs
Yes, through tools and solutions that integrate with the official API. The Instagram Login API is Meta’s official system that allows external platforms to securely connect with professional accounts and manage interactions such as Direct Messages and comments. The automations available in Meta Business Suite are basic and limited to welcome messages or saved replies. In contrast, tools like Easypromos, which work with the official API, allow you to create more advanced flows: trigger conversations from comments or Stories, chain messages with buttons, and structure automated journeys within DMs.
Public replies in the comment section cannot be automated directly. However, you can automate the sending of a private message when a user comments with an activation keyword. In this case, the automation detects the keyword and moves the interaction to the Direct Message channel, where the conversation starts automatically.
No. There are solutions that allow you to configure automations without technical development.
Not necessarily. When implemented correctly, automation improves response speed and creates a smoother experience for users.